Tony Bennett quits Veritas
http://veritas.netfreehost.com/viewt...mforum=veritas
Quote:
In answer to presterjohn, I sent this note out by e-mail to VERITAS members on Thursday last (12 May):
"Dear VERITAS members,
I wish to infom you that on Tuesday I gave formal notice to Robert KIlroy-Silk and Acting Party Secretary Michael Harvey that I have decided to resign my membership of VERITAS, for personal reasons
Tony Bennett
01279 635789"
-------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
In answer to those who have 'phoned here asking for more details, I have explained that I spent time helping to found and establish the party, worked for its development and stood in the General Election as a candidate.
All of this has taken much time away from my main role whch is to deal effectively with Robert's constituency correspondence and enquiries and indeed the correspondence, e-mails and telephone calls which come in from all over the country every time he appears on TV or radio. Quite a backlog has inevitably built up.
I decided that the additional work of being a Party member and dealing with enquiries and indeed representations from Party members as well was too much. Plus many enquiries come in here for VERITAS, either via Robert's website or through Directory Enquiries; I can now truthfully say I am not in VERITAS and direct the enquiries elsewhere
